Globe Powers Up Filipino Students to Lead, Create, and Spark Change

Globe empowers Filipino students through the Community Builders Program, offering leadership training, student grants, and mentorship opportunities to help shape the next generation of changemakers. (Photo from Globe)

Globe is stepping up for Filipino students with programs that fuel their passions, grow leadership skills, and open doors to real-world opportunities. Through its Globe Community Builders Program, the telco empowers youth to become changemakers in a fast-moving world.

Globe offers a lot of ways for students to get involved in the Globe Community Builders Program. Students can unlock daily perks and essentials through the Student Rewards on the GlobeOne app. If students have big ideas, they can pitch them through Globe Student Grants on the Globe website— and the best ones can partner with Globe to bring their ideas to life. Students can pitch their organized events, projects, and connect with mentors, and take a more active role in shaping their communities. Internships are also available for those ready to start building their careers early.

One example of this in action happened in May when Globe organized the Marvel Studios’ Thunderbolts* led by the Marketing Youth Culture department. Student leaders from different high schools and universities were invited to special block screenings held in select Metro Manila, Nueva Ecija, Cagayan de Oro, and Davao cinemas. Apart from enjoying the movie, they were also given the opportunity to connect with Globe mentors and learn more about joining the Globe Community Builders Program, where they could take a more active role in leading projects, organizing events, and building their leadership skills.
